This request for quotation (RFQ) seeks bids for the supply of an hiv awareness kit. Bidders must complete and sign the bidder's disclosure form (sbd 4), disclosing any employment by an organ of state, relationships with procuring institution employees, and all csd-registered active companies linked to directors. Failure to disclose all linked companies or being listed on the register for tender defaulters or list of restricted suppliers will result in automatic disqualification.
Complete and sign the Bidder's Disclosure form (SBD 4) and submit it with the quotation.
Disclose all CSD-registered active companies linked to all directors; failure to do so leads to disqualification.
Bidders listed on the Register for Tender Defaulters or the List of Restricted Suppliers are automatically disqualified.
Declare whether the bidder or any directors/trustees/shareholders/members/partners are employed by an organ of state (as defined in section 239 of the Constitution).
Declare any relationship with any person employed by the procuring institution.
Declare any interest in any other related enterprise, whether or not bidding for this contract.
Certify that the bid was arrived at independently and without collusion with competitors; false declarations will disqualify the bid.
